To celebrate both their recent Warwick opening, the Law Firm of Lonardo, Forte and Trudeau, LLP., will hold an Open House Thursday, September 28, at 2890 West Shore Road, from 2:30 to 7:00 p.m. This event is free and open to the public. Light refreshments and hour d’oeuvres will be served.
A ribbon-cutting ceremony co-hosted by the Central Rhode Island Chamber of Commerce. Among those invited to attend are Senate President Dominic Ruggiero, Warwick Mayor Frank Picozzi, State Senator Mark McKenney and House Speaker Joseph Shekarchi.
Additionally, the event will feature door prizes and 50/50 raffles with the proceeds going to benefit CASA (Court Appointed Special Advocate that helps children in need), and the Potters League Animal Rescue in Warwick.
One of the firm’s Partners, Melina Trudeau, said local businesses and families with legal and professional questions can rest easy knowing their requests will get resolved.
The firm specializes in litigation, foreclosures, title/real estate and advisory services. Their focus as attorneys is counselors at law. They are more than simply delivering documents and providing advice. They look to build long and meaningful relationships with their clients to help them build and grow.
Elizabeth “Liz” Lonardo, Mike Forte and Melina Trudeau joined forces in 2021 to start the firm with the goal of being a small business designed to serve and help other small businesses. They are native Rhode Islanders committed to serving the state and communities where they live and work.
